What is Reverse Wireless Charging?
Reverse wireless charging, also known as “wireless power sharing,” is a technology that allows a smartphone or other compatible device to wirelessly charge other devices. This essentially flips the script on traditional wireless charging, where a charging pad provides power to the device. With reverse wireless charging, your phone becomes the power source, capable of transferring energy to other gadgets.
How Does it Work?
The technology relies on the same principles as standard wireless charging: electromagnetic induction. A compatible device with reverse wireless charging capabilities has a transmitter coil that generates a magnetic field. When placed near a compatible receiver device, this magnetic field induces an electric current, effectively charging the receiver wirelessly.

Challenges and Considerations
- Limited Power Output: Reverse wireless charging typically offers a lower power output compared to charging directly from a wall adapter. It’s not meant for rapid charging but rather for providing a small boost of power.
- Device Compatibility: Not all devices support reverse wireless charging. Both the sending and receiving devices must have the necessary hardware and software support.
- Heat Generation: The process can generate some heat, which may be noticeable during extended charging sessions.

Samsung’s Dominance in Reverse Wireless Charging
A Legacy of Innovation
Samsung has been a pioneer in reverse wireless charging technology, integrating it into many of its flagship smartphones since the Samsung Galaxy S10. This feature, known as Wireless PowerShare, allows users to wirelessly charge other Qi-compatible devices by placing them on the back of the Samsung phone. This capability has made Samsung devices stand out in the market, offering a unique and convenient charging solution.
